35.2.13 I
2
C-bus Bit Rate Low-Level Register (ICBRL)
ICBRL is a 5-bit register to set the low period of SCL.
It also works to generate the data setup time for automatic SCL low-hold operation (refer to
section 35.8, Automatic
Low-Hold Function for SCL
); when the RIIC is used only in slave mode, this register needs to be set to a value longer
than the data setup time
*
1
.
ICBRL counts the low period with the internal reference clock (IICφ) specified by the ICMR1.CKS[2:0] bits.
If the digital noise filter is enabled (the ICFER.NFE bit is 1), set the ICBRL register to a value at least one greater than
the number of stages in the noise filter. Regarding the number of stages in the noise filter, see the description of the
ICMR3.NF[1:0] bits.
Note 1. Data setup time (tSU: DAT)
250 ns (up to 100 kbps: Standard-mode (Sm))
100 ns (up to 400 kbps: Fast-mode (Fm))
